Prospect Consumer Products  (BOM:543814) Current Ratio Explanation

The current ratio can give a sense of the efficiency of a company's operating cycle or its ability to turn its product into cash. Companies that have trouble getting paid on their receivables or have long inventory turnover can run into liquidity problems because they are unable to alleviate their obligations. Because business operations differ in each industry, it is always more useful to compare companies within the same industry.

Acceptable current ratios vary from industry to industry and are generally between 1 and 3 for healthy businesses.

The higher the current ratio, the more capable the company is of paying its obligations. A ratio under 1 suggests that the company would be unable to pay off its obligations if they came due at that point. While this shows the company is not in good financial health, it does not necessarily mean that it will go bankrupt - as there are many ways to access financing - but it is definitely not a good sign.

If all other things were equal, a creditor, who is expecting to be paid in the next 12 months, would consider a high current ratio to be better than a low current ratio, because a high current ratio means that the company is more likely to meet its liabilities which fall due in the next 12 months.

Prospect Consumer Products Business Description

Address Rajpath Rangoli Road, 417, Sun Orbit Behind Rajpath Club Road, Bodakdev, Ahmedabad, GJ, IND, 380054
Prospect Consumer Products Ltd is engaged in the cashew trading business. It processes, trades, exports, and supplies natural and flavored cashew kernels under the brand DRIFRUTZ. The company also deals in cashew by-products such as husk, husk pellets, and shells. Its operations include a cashew processing plant near Ahmedabad, Gujarat, catering to both domestic and international markets. Revenue is generated through the sale and export of cashew kernels and related products across wholesale business-to-business channels.
